Comparing Viagra’s Duration to Other ED Medications
Viagra’s effectiveness typically lasts 4-5 hours. However, the duration of intercourse isn’t solely determined by the medication’s active time; individual factors play a significant role. Let’s compare it to other common options.
Cialis (Tadalafil): Cialis boasts a much longer duration, often lasting up to 36 hours. This makes it a popular choice for men seeking spontaneity. The extended duration allows for multiple opportunities for intercourse within this timeframe.
Levitra (Vardenafil): Levitra’s duration is similar to Viagra, generally lasting 4-5 hours. Its onset of action may be slightly faster than Viagra for some individuals.
Stendra (Avanafil): Stendra’s advantage lies in its rapid onset of action; it works faster than Viagra, Levitra, and Cialis. However, its overall duration is comparable to Viagra and Levitra, typically around 4-6 hours. This makes it a suitable option for those needing a quicker response.
The best choice depends on individual needs and preferences. Consider discussing your specific circumstances and expectations with your doctor to determine which medication best suits you.

When to Consult a Doctor Regarding Viagra Duration
If Viagra doesn’t help you achieve satisfactory intercourse duration, or if you experience side effects, contact your doctor. This includes persistent pain, vision changes, hearing loss, or prolonged erection (priapism), lasting more than four hours. These require immediate medical attention.
Unexpected Side Effects
Report any unexpected side effects, even seemingly minor ones, to your physician. This could include headaches, flushing, nasal congestion, or indigestion. Your doctor can assess if adjustments to your dosage or a different treatment option are needed. Proper monitoring ensures your safety and treatment efficacy.
